Two of Iman al-Nouri’s 5 sons have been killed on Thursday’s Israeli strike, whereas a 3rd was critically wounded

Iman al-Nouri’s youngest son, two-year-old Siraj, awoke crying from starvation on Thursday and requested to get some dietary dietary supplements.

Siraj’s 14-year-old cousin, Sama, agreed to take him and two of his older brothers – Omar, 9, and Amir, 5 – to the Altayara well being clinic in Deir al-Balah, central Gaza.

“The [medical] level was nonetheless closed, in order that they have been sitting on the pavement when immediately we heard the sound of the strike,” Iman instructed a neighborhood journalist working for the BBC.

“I went to [my husband] and stated: ‘Your youngsters, Hatim! They went to the purpose.'”

Family handout Iman al-Nouri's son, AmirHousehold handout

Amir, 5, was killed immediately within the Israeli strike, in accordance with Iman

Warning: This piece incorporates graphic descriptions of loss of life and violence

Iman, a 32-year-old mom of 5, rushed to the scene after listening to the strike, solely to seek out her sons and niece mendacity on a donkey cart that was getting used to move casualties to the hospital as a result of there have been no ambulances.

Amir and Sama have been among the many lifeless, whereas Omar and Siraj have been critically wounded.

“Omar nonetheless had some breath in him. They tried to revive him,” Iman recalled. “Omar wanted blood, and it took them an hour to get it. They gave it to him, however it was in useless.”

“Why are they gone? Why? What did they do mistaken?” she requested.

“That they had desires similar to some other youngsters on this planet. Should you gave them a small toy, they’d be so comfortable. They have been simply youngsters.”

Family handout Iman al-Nouri's son Omar (right) and one of his elder brothersHousehold handout

9-year-old Omar (proper), pictured together with his elder brother, died of his wounds in hospital

Iman stated Siraj’s head was bleeding and he had misplaced a watch – a picture that she can’t now get out of her head.

“He had fractures in his cranium and… in accordance with the physician, not simply bleeding, however [a major haemorrhage] on his mind,” she added. “How lengthy can he keep like this, residing on oxygen? Two are already gone. If solely he may assist me maintain on slightly longer.”

Tragically, docs have stated they’re unable to deal with Siraj.

“Since yesterday at 07:00 till now, he is in the identical situation. He is nonetheless respiratory, his chest rises and falls, he nonetheless has breath in him. Save him!” she pleaded.

Family handout Iman al-Nouri's son, SirajHousehold handout

Iman stated docs had instructed her that they have been unable to deal with two-year-old Siraj

A spokesperson for the US-based support group Mission Hope, which runs the Altayara clinic, instructed the BBC that the strike occurred at round 07:15.

Ladies and youngsters have been ready outdoors earlier than it opened at 09:00, in an effort to be first in line for diet and different well being providers, Dr Mithqal Abutaha stated.

CCTV footage of the Israeli air strike exhibits two males strolling alongside a road, simply metres away from a bunch of ladies and youngsters. Moments later, there’s an explosion subsequent to the lads and the air is full of mud and smoke.

In a graphic video exhibiting the aftermath of the assault, many lifeless and severely wounded youngsters and adults are seen mendacity on the bottom.

“Please get my daughter an ambulance,” one girl calls out as she tends to a younger lady. However for a lot of it was too late for assist.”

Dr Abutaha stated 16 folks have been killed, together with 10 youngsters and three girls.

The Israeli navy stated it focused a “Hamas terrorist” and that it regretted any hurt to what it referred to as “uninvolved people”, whereas including that the incident was underneath overview.

Mission Hope stated the strike was “a blatant violation of worldwide humanitarian regulation, and a stark reminder that nobody and no place is protected in Gaza”.

Dr Abutaha stated it was “insufferable” when he discovered that folks have been killed “the place they [were] in search of their fundamental humanitarian and human rights”.

He questioned the Israeli navy’s assertion on the strike, together with its expression of remorse, saying that it “can’t convey these sufferers, these beneficiaries again alive”.

He additionally stated that the clinic was a UN-recognised, “deconflicted humanitarian facility”, and that no navy actions ought to have taken place close by.

Anadolu via Getty Images Palestinians hold out pans at a charity kitchen in the al-Rimal neighbourhood of Gaza City (11 July 2025)Anadolu by way of Getty Photographs

The UN says there are millions of malnourished youngsters throughout Gaza

Iman stated her youngsters used to go to the clinic each two or three days to get dietary dietary supplements as a result of she and Hatim weren’t in a position to give them sufficient meals.

“Their father dangers his life simply to convey them flour. When he goes to Netzarim [military corridor north of Deir al-Balah], my coronary heart breaks. He goes there to convey meals or flour.”

“Does anybody have something? There is not any meals. What else would make a baby scream if he did not need one thing?”

Israel imposed a complete blockade of support deliveries to Gaza initially of March and resumed its navy offensive in opposition to Hamas two weeks later, collapsing a two-month ceasefire. It stated it needed to place stress on the Palestinian armed group to launch Israeli hostages.

Though the blockade was partially eased in late Could, amid warnings of a looming famine from world specialists, there are nonetheless extreme shortages of meals, in addition to medication and gas.

The UN company for Palestinian refugees (Unrwa) says there are millions of malnourished youngsters throughout the territory, with extra instances detected day by day.

Dr Abutaha stated Mission Hope had additionally observed an alarming rise in instances of malnutrition amongst adults, which they’d not noticed earlier than in Gaza.

Along with permitting in some UN support lorries, Israel and the US helped arrange a brand new support distribution system run by the Gaza Humanitarian Basis (GHF), saying they needed to forestall Hamas from stealing support. However since then, there have been nearly day by day experiences of individuals being killed by Israeli fireplace whereas in search of meals.

The UN human rights workplace stated on Friday that it had thus far recorded 798 such killings, together with 615 within the neighborhood of the GHF’s websites, that are operated by US personal safety contractors and situated inside navy zones in southern and central Gaza. The opposite 183 killings have been recorded close to UN and different support convoys.

The Israeli navy stated it recognised there had been incidents wherein civilians had been harmed and that it was working to minimise “potential friction between the inhabitants and the [Israeli] forces as a lot as potential”.

The GHF accused the UN of utilizing “false and deceptive” statistics from Gaza’s Hamas-run well being ministry.

Iman al-Nouri (2nd right), her husband Hatim (right) and two of their sons look at photos on a mobile phone

Iman stated a ceasefire “means nothing to me after my youngsters are gone”

Dr Abutaha referred to as on Israel to permit in sufficient meals, medication and gas to fulfill the essential humanitarian wants of everybody in Gaza, in order that “everybody may have a dignified life”.

He additionally expressed concern that folks have been being given “false hope” that Israel and Hamas may quickly agree a brand new ceasefire deal.

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u stated on Thursday that an settlement on a 60-day truce and the discharge of 28 hostages could possibly be simply days away.

However Palestinian officers stated on Friday evening that the oblique talks in Qatar have been getting ready to collapse due to vital gaps remaining on points like Israeli troop withdrawals and Hamas’s rejection of an Israeli plan to maneuver all of Gaza’s inhabitants right into a camp in Rafah.

“On daily basis they discuss a ceasefire, however the place is it?” Iman stated.

“They’ve killed us by way of starvation, by way of gunfire, by way of bombs, by way of air strikes. We have died in each potential method.”

“It is higher to go to God than stick with any of them. Could God give me persistence.”
